Skateboard with brake

  • US 4,055,234 A
  • Filed: 07/29/1976
  • Issued: 10/25/1977
  • Est. Priority Date: 07/29/1976
  • Status: Expired due to Term
First Claim
Patent Images

1. A skateboard comprisinga. an elongated rigid body member having forward and rearward ends and also having top and bottom surfaces,b. wheel assemblies on the bottom of said body member adjacent each end,c. each of said wheel assemblies having a pair of wheels,d. a slide member mounted on the bottom side of said body member for longitudinal adjustable movement,e. a cross frame support,f. brake shoe means on said cross frame support adjacent to said wheels,g. a single vertically disposed pivot means connecting said cross frame support to said slide member whereby said cross frame support and said brake shoe means can pivot with side turning of the wheels,h. an upright brake pedal extending through said body member and having an upper foot engaging portion,i. and link means operative by said brake pedal providing longitudinal movement of said slide member to engage the brake shoes against the wheels upon a brake actuating movement of said brake pedal.
